Madden 24 - Kansas City Chiefs Playbook

The Chiefs Offensive Playbook this year is really fun and unique. Probably the most complete book in the game as they have literally several great undercenter formations and several great Shotgun formations. Every Madden player has a certain style of play. I feel like this book can suit anyone because of the variety it brings.  There are a lot of plays that are only in this book (Commanders has same book) like different Speed Options, RPOS, pass concepts, etc. I really like their Singleback Deuce Close / Gun Deuce Close combo. I really like their Gun Bunch Str Nasty and I feel like Gun Bunch Nasty has potential. Gun Trio Wk, Pistol Bunch TE, and their Gun Tight Open are all atleast somewhat usable because of the Speed Option.

Litez's Top 3 Plays From His Top 5 Favorite Formations in Kansas City Chiefs Playbook Madden 24

Singleback Deuce Close - These 3 plays together only found in this book and Wash. Add the fact that it has an 01 Trap and we're looking at one of the best SB Deuce Close's in Madden 24

 

Gun Deuce Close - I really like that Crosser/In Route in PA Post Cross. Not to mention it has a Skinny Post you can use to bomb. Inside Zone is going to be very good, and the Corner Gos Flat will be also with a Slot App. Don't forget this also has RPO Read Flat Wheel.

 

Gun Bunch Str Nasty - Can't do a Top 3 Plays for this one; it's too good. On paper this has so many high powered routes. Now we have to see if they translate to the virtual gridiron.

Gun Trio Wk - Really wish it had an RPO Bubble but it has a Speed Option which makes you really need to have run D left, right, and middle. I'm not going to focus on Pistol Bunch TE but that set also has a deadly Speed Option in it!

Gun Bunch X Nasty - This is probably the best playbook when it comes to Bunch Nasty. It can be good but at the same time I don't know if there are 3 plays that stick out as the absolute best 3. With a Slot Apprentice to the X receiver it'll really open this formation up.

Thoughts & Analysis on the Kansas City Chiefs Madden 24 Playbook by Brobean

  •  Singleback Wing Nasty, Wing Tight Left

If you’re a jumbo player, this would be a nice playbook to focus on.  The Wing Nasty and Wing Left are new formations.  The plays are limited but, like a lot of these formations, can be greatly enchanted with a HRM QB.  Out of Wing Tight left, PA Scissors has two deep corners and a post, all compressed.  Can create some cool route combos and create confusion with the use of motion.  Additionally you can motion out the rb to create easier flood concepts while still being able to block.  It also has a wide zone run, dive, and the WR on a deep corner route out of PA sprint HB flat.

 

  •  SB Deuce Close

A staple of Madden for years, deuce close has been toned down quite a bit.  The chiefs have one of the better ones, but still missing some plays.  The run game has a trap to hit up the middle and a flippable stretch.  If the run is good this year, having your opponent set up run defense first could really open up the pass.  Bench is an old favorite.  PA X Post Cross may be one of the best plays in Madden this year.  If skinny posts from compression are as effective as they were in the beta, being able to flip this will be a nightmare.  Could be great against man or zone.  PA misdirection is a great complement to both these passing plays.  That post is great against man or middle thirds, as it was getting underneath in the beta.  (Here we have post/corner going same way again).  The fact you can flip it, wheel the rb, and block, it’s a really nice set of 3 plays.  Unfortunately we’re missing TE angle, but once TE apprentice is available in MUT, this could be deadly.  Definitely a formation to keep your eye on.

 

  •  SB Ace Slot

Has a flippable wide zone, dive, and flippable power o.  Could be nice as a quick audible

 

  •  Pistol Bunch TE

This version has a speed option and a Jet Touch Pass which could be hell to defend.  Speed option is flippable so your opponent has to respect that to each side.  Pass plays are limited to Cross Drag, which is a really nice quick snap play.  Spot Y Option has a sharp corner to the point WR.  Can Flood the strong side with this play, and middle of field with Cross Drag.  A nice complementary that has quick hike written all over it.

 

  •  Gun Deuce Close

If paired with SB version, it could be good.  It’s really missing a few pass plays.  The new one to talk about is PA Post Cross.  You now have a deep post on the weak side of the formation.  Also, the deep crosser by the strong side WR is really good against zones.  Unless a cloud is set to 30 yards, nothing else will play it (was getting above 30 yard clouds in early part of beta, may have been changed).  Still has read flat wheel which was so OP last year, it forced EA to patch it.

 

  •  Gun Trio HB Weak

These formations are super annoying to defend when run by someone competent.  With the run game, you have a speed option which is already designed to attach the trips side.  This formation is already hard to blitz on the trip side.  If you’re running that way with your QB, it could be really nice.  The RPO pin alert bubble, paired with the speed option, has a bunch of lineman pulling.  If your opponent is running man and the Te side is naked, you could have a huge numbers advantage.  Also has an inside zone and an alert bubble.  This has the potential to be one of the best Gun run sets in the game.  The passing game is a bit underwhelming.  Tons of crossers going from strong to weak side.  We’re missing a real way of attaching the trips sideline.  Once HRM drops, this could be a nice off meta scheme.

 

  •  Gun Bunch Strg Nasty

The most unique Bunch Strg Nasty in the game.  With 4 receiving threats to one side, match will be exposed.  You can block the TE and motion the RB out and block him as well.  The RPO zone read bubble is hell.  Pass it to the WR, hand it to the RB, or just keep it with the QB.  There are 3 things your opponent has to worry about.  Inside zone is there but moreso, this pin pull toss.  Once O-LINE run abilities drop in MUT, this is going to be insane.  As mentioned in other write ups, toss plays haven’t been good in years, but this may have potential.  You can attack every area with the run game.  Flanker drive gives you a corner route to the TE.  But this PA double post play is the main passing option.  Those two posts have different depths and, during the beta, deep zones were awful.  This play led to so many bombs.  This formation just screams deep passing game to me.  PA corner gives you a deep corner, a crosser and a C route, so your opponent can’t just worry about being bombed from middle routes.  PA Cross has the all important deep post, with crosser coming from the opposite direction.  Without a slot/te apprentice, this formation is like money play central.  It could end up being very potent from the launch of the game.

 

  •  Gun Bunch X Nasty 

One click to the right, this formation has more short routes (pivots, whips, speed outs).  But it still has corners and a very unique post in post wheel shallow.  These two formation can really work well together and probably the strength of this book.

 

  •  Gun Tight Open

This was the formation I was in for the first few days of the beta.  The spacing is really nice.  Verticals HB Burst was crushing man and zone.  As things progressed, not having a TE on the line to block, seemed detrimental.  The play Slot post has a nice post, with a drag and wheel which space nicely.  It also has a speed option.  This can be a nice formation to audible to and quick hike the speed option, or either of the pass plays mentioned above.

 

  •  Gun Spread Double Flex Weak

Motion Corner, Drive, and Smash.  A fun little auto motion scheme with 3 plays.  

 

Overall Thoughts:  This book has so much variety.  It doesn’t have traditional Meta formations like Bunch or Trips Te.  This is a book to use if you like a run game with RPO’s and speed options.  I think the best way of using this may be to audible around and hit a quick rpo or speed option before your opponent can get setup.  The Bunch Nasty’s are the strength if you want pure traditional passing.  The book is definitely gimmicky (ala Andy Reid in real life), but it’s a super fun unique way to play the game
